Project: Mano M37 Gran Sport

Mano seems to be putting a lot of new models in recent time and after launching its M42,50 flagship in early Summer this Italian boat builder moves on to present this M37 Gran Sport project. The M37 Grand Sport seems an expansion of the M32 Gran Sport project presented over a year ago and is designed by Naples firm Cabes Yachts. Taking innovation at heart both Mano and Cabes present a center console with a full length cockpit with cabin spaces nearly competing to those of a cruiser in similar sizes, with a lower deck offering an owners cabin to fore, double berth to midship, shower head, L-shaped saloon, and galley. The 37 Gran Sport is also full of options not only to color choices, but also to what regards its fitting out. Its exterior offers four choices to decide from; the radar arch model as the picture above, full open, T-bar, and last a glassed hard top covering all the center console. You also have inside options where an owner can choose to swap the galley for a second settee. With this you will have the galley on the main deck, which stands behind the central helm position only. But can be an interesting option for those who use such a boat mostly in Summer. Choices again are vast to what regards powering the M37 Gran Sport with a total of eleven engines from Mercruiser, Volvo, and Yanmar from twin 220 up to 320hp. Propulsion comes from all the stern drives from these three engine manufactures, and the option of a Volvo IPS pod drive option.

New Model: Astondoa 50 Fly

Astondoa launches its new 50 Fly model, a flybridge motor yacht of just fifteen metres which features incredible spaces for its size. May be the only sin for the Christian Gatto designed 50 Fly just as the smaller 44 sister is just for copying too much the triangle bow of a certain Italian builder, but for the rest the 50 Fly breaks new ground in this size for its space which is over whelming. The 50 Fly has also to be appreciated because it does this without looking too heavy on the lines. The most important area of the 50 Fly is its lower deck, this place having three double cabins, and two heads. Nothing new here, sure but the owners stateroom is full beam, and the third cabin is no bunk. So that is also an improvement on the Astondoa 55. You can also get an extra crew cabin which stands behind the master room as optional. The main deck is the other thing to like, and versus recent designs goes a bit backwards having a split level saloon with dining and helm in the raised part, and saloon with C-shaped sofa and entertainment desk on the lower welcome area. Power is from standard twin Cummins 600hp in a shaft propulsion configuration, although to get these spaces I am sure the ZF Integral vee drive units are used. None the less nothing wrong here, but according to some dealers web site an IPS option just as the smaller 44 should be available here with IPS800 choice. 
Technical Data:
LOA - 15.22 m (49.9ft)
Hull Length - 15.02 m
Beam - 4.6 m
Draft - 1.3 m
Displacement - 18.5 t
Fuel Capacity - 1700 l
Water Capacity - 420 l
Accommodation - 6 berths in 3 cabins, 1 crew berth
Max Persons - 10
Engines - 2 x Cummins QSC8.3 600hp
Propulsion - line shaft
Speed - 30 knots max, 26 knots cruise
Range - 300 nm at 26 knots
Project - Christian Gatto
Certification - CE B

Engine: FPT C90 650hp

As every year FPT, Fiat Powertrain Technologies presents a new edition to its range of marine engines at the world’s most important nautical event. The new C90 650 engine is according to FPT the best in its class, thanks to its outstanding power output, extremely quiet running and excellent reliability and efficiency, all packed in extremely compact measurements, a combination that makes it the ideal choice for leisure boats up to sixteen metres long. Confirming the technological excellence and innovation that distinguish all FPT marine engines, the new engine features the latest advances in engineering technology that are available on the market. This new straight-6 cylinder, 8.7 litre engine has 4-valve-per-cylinder timing and a sophisticated fuel supply system with a second generation Common Rail with electronic control incorporated into the cylinder head cover, which has unquestioned advantages in terms of safety and noise abatement. Turbocharging is provided by a water-cooled fixed geometry turbo blower with a waste-gate valve and after-cooling. These features enable the new C90 650 to deliver a maximum power output of 650hp at 2530 rpm, and engine torque of 2,152 Nm at 1,700 rpm. The excellent specific power output of 74.71 Hp/litre is the highest in its class and further proof of the outstanding efficiency of the C90 650. The cutting edge technology that went into the design and development of the new C90 650 has made it possible to combine sporty performance and low specific consumption of 228.5 g/kWh. Thanks to modern injection systems and electronic management, the engine has a minimal environmental impact and respects the most restrictive international standards, including Imo Marpol, Epa Recreational and 2003/44/EC. The characteristic measurements of the C90 650 make it another winner, even where ease of installation is concerned; this is underlined by the excellent weight-power, and volume-power ratios, which are respectively just 1.45 kg/Hp and 1.48 dm3/Hp, setting new benchmarks for its class. The overall weight of the new C90 650 is just 940kg. The C90 650 engine will be available on the market from early 2011.

New Launch: F&S 54 Hull 15

F&S from Delaware presents this new 54 feet Hull number 15. Designed by Applied Concepts this cold molded custom built Sportfish Yacht is for a repeated customer who with this launch is now on his third F&S following 62 Hull 8 from 2006, and the 2007 built 45 Hull 10. Applied Concepts and Jim Flloyd's F&S presented a Sportfish Yacht which certainly is coming from the future with innovative super structures being testimony to the revolution this 54 feet classic Carolina lined hull wants to show. F&S hull number fifteen breaks the mold indeed with its all-weather bridge and unique composite tower. The main deck area is also a living closed-open cross over, having comforts associated with a flybridge but being a light filled area. The revolutionary tower built of composite sits on the hard top which covers the main deck, and indeed it does offer the comfort of a flybridge, although space is limited to two persons. The main deck welcomes you on its two step raised area with the mezzanine and full entertainment relax zone under the hard top which has an L-shaped settee, a central pompano style helm station with bolster style seat, and two co-pilot seats. Down below the interior has been made simple with a spacious C-shaped sofa, two open bunk berths, galley, shower head, and an owners stateroom to fore. Power to this 54 Hull 15 is for not so big twin Cats 1015hp.
Technical Data:
LOA - 16.54 m (54ft)
Fuel Capacity - 3785 l
Accommodation - 4 berths in 2 cabins
Engines - 2 x Cats C18 1015hp
Propulsion - line shaft
Construction - cold molded wood with epoxy resin, glassed and AWL Grip painted
Project -Applied Concepts

Project: Pershing 58

After no new models launched in 2009, Pershing wants to make the 2010 year one full of them, presenting three novelties in this years fall, and after taking the 50.1 in Cannes, at Genoa it presented the 58. As it is easy to see with this rendering this new 58 comes from the updating of the successful 56 model launched in 2005. With the Pershing 58 Fulvio De Simoni updates the super structure, and adds the hull with six large view windows, three per side situated in all of the three large cabins below. As those who follow Pershing can see the hard top now takes the New Idea looks as presented with the 72 in 2007, and there after followed by all new models launched since then. In particular De Simoni 58 new hard top lines take a lot of inspiration from the 72, 64, 80, and the new 92.

New Model: Atlantis 44

Atlantis presents the page two of its new direction with second 44 model debuting at Genoa. Important to note that both the new Atlantis models represented a full novelty and where not just a make up change to an old design. The 44 replaces two units from Altantis who both sold quite well, the 42 which was the first badged Atlantis, and the top selling Gobbi designed 425 SC. Young designers Neo Design who take over from Righini as expected bring a family feeling to the details shown on the 48 presented just about a month ago in Cannes. You have the open feeling with a hard top which is light on features, and the cockpit although smaller features a similar layout to the bigger sister with a sun pad aft, C-shaped dinette, galley opposite, and lounger under the windscreen. The interior has also a similar layout to the 48, with a full beam owners room, VIP suite to fore, galley, and a C-shaped saloon. Basically if you compare it to the 48 you miss a high low bathing platform, a smaller aft deck, and stern drive propulsion instead of line shafts. Stern drives do consume less to shaft or pods, although higher maintenance costs are to be had. Power for the Atlantis 44 comes from Cummins 350hp with an unusual for a European builder for having a Bravo Three dual propeller propulsion set up. So far there seems to be no Volvo option, we will see if this will change.
Technical Data:
LOA - 13.43 m (44ft)
Beam - 4.25 m
Fuel Capacity - 900 l
Water Capacity - 350 l
Accommodation - 4 + 2 berths
Max Persons - 12
Engines - 2 x Cummins QSD 4.2 350hp
Propulsion - Mercruiser Bravo Three dual propeller stern drive
Construction - infusion resin moulding
Project - Neo Design
Certification - CE B

New Model: Mondomarine 40 Meters Semidisplacement

A success on the market for its super yachts induced Mondomarine to launch the 40 Metres Semidispacement. Unlike recent Mondomarine which are built of alloy or steel this 40 meter named Villa Reis was built in fiberglass composite material. This new model is based on an in house project by Mondomarine design team, with an interior by architect Luca Dini. The external lines of this 40 Metres Semidispalcement which is the the fifty fourth yacht boasting the logo by the Shipyard of Savona related to Mondo Group of Gallo D’Alba, are characterized, by the wheelhouse, perfectly circular and with a semi circle view. A difference is the positioning of the sun-deck area, provided with a Jacuzzi, in the outside bow area of the upper deck, instead to the usual stern cockpit or on the sun-deck. The interior layout, rather traditional in the layout and with a neo-classical touch, includes the owner’s suite complete with a study in the wide body area of the main deck, a large salon with dining room and the galley on the same deck. Four guest cabins are located on the lower deck while the upper deck includes a living room, a gym full of light, the Captain’s cabin and the wheelhouse. The interiors with their sober and elegant lines, the meticulous care for stylistic details, the use of light wood for the floors of salon and lounge and of Italian Walnut wood and Radica of Madrona for the furniture, the marbles of great value and the ceilings in light Alcantara make the rooms warm and comfortable and emphasize their classic and elegant character. Power is from twin MTU 1500hp which give a 17 knots top speed, a 15 knots cruise, and an economic 11 knots which gives 2600 nautical miles.
Technical Data:
LOA - 39.4 m (129.2ft)
Waterline Length - 32.6 m
Beam - 8.80 m
Draft - 2.33 m
Displacement - 240 t loaded, 195 t light
Fuel Capacity - 37500 l
Water Capacity - 6300 l
Accommodation - 5 double guest cabins, 7 crew berths
Engines - 2 x MTU 12V2000M91 1500hp
Propulsion - line shaft
Speed - 17 knots max, 15 knots cruise, 11 knots economic cruise
Range - 2600 nm at 11 knots
Construction - GRP
Project - Luca Dini interior, Mondomarine concept and exterior
Certification - RINA Cross of Malta MACH Y Short Range

Project: Codecasa 50 Serie Vintage

Codecasa the Italian super yacht builder presents this new interesting 50 meters project which also launches the new Vintage series line. Codecasa has so far in its history always produced sport yachts with planning hull and a complete alloy build, or the three decks moving palaces who in most cases have a steel hull, aluminium super structure and semi displacement underwater shapes. This new 50 Vintage will have a construction as the standard three decks Codecasa super yachts, that is of steel hull and alloy super structure. Its design focus is on having traditional looks like an axe bow coming from the early twentieth century ships, straight lines, and a stern which although sloop also represents the past. Accommodation will be for five double guest cabins of which three being VIP, and an owners apartment. Crew accommodation is for eight members in four cabins, plus a chief engineer and captains cabin. Power is from twin 2448hp Cat engines which will give a 17 knots top speed at light load, and a 12 knots cruise which gives a 6000 nautical miles range till you need to refuel one hundred thousand litres of diesel.

Improve-it = Maxi Dolphin MD51 Power

Maxi Dolphin launches a new improved version of the MD51 Power. This sport yacht is once again the expression of the Maxi Dolphin philosophy to build custom projects suited to the clients needs. Here it combines the designer style typical of its range with advanced technological research resulting in a unique sport yacht. This new version has also the capability to handle all electric, electronic and infotainment systems through an Apple i-Pad, which is located on the noticeable central aileron radar arch. But this improved MD51 Power achieves a lot more by reviewing some of the components, such as: carbon inserts on the boat sides, that set off the metallic light blue paint of the hull; windscreen extended to aft, offering extra protection; air outlet grills on the transom enlarged, to underline the power of the craft; prow with integrated Led navigation lights and the drive seat turned into a one place capsule. The interior arrangement is an open space; with many details and parts in carbon fibre like the companionway’s steps, skirting boards, washbasin and centre table enhancing this sport yacht look. Power for this sophisticated open sport yacht is twin Volvo 435hp with IPS forward looking dual propeller drives propulsion giving a max speed of 38 knots.
